PAOK FC owner Ivan Savvidis sets championship and Champions League goals

During a PAOK FC Board of Directors meeting, owner Ivan Savvidis outlined the club's primary objectives: winning the championship and securing participation in the Champions League for the next season. Savvidis emphasized an ongoing total restructuring of the organization, urging all staff to operate as a unified team.

As part of this reorganization, Anastasios Zikas, CEO of Thessaloniki Exhibition Center, has been appointed as an advisor to the President and the Board. Zikas will focus on internal organization, service coordination, and the implementation of new technologies within the club.

Regarding infrastructure, Savvidis expressed confidence that all necessary procedures for the new Nea Toumpa stadium will be completed by next summer to allow construction to begin. Additionally, plans are underway for a new training center in Thermi, with work expected to start in 2026. The club also aims to have the Kavazoglou Stadium fully ready to host matches by the end of the current season.
